Alabama beekeepers trained a bee-allergic A-lister — and now you can taste the honey that was actually in the movie.
Irondale-based Foxhound Bee Company and neighboring bee companies, who supplied the bees and trained Matthew McConaughey during the production of The Rivals of Amziah King movie, are selling Alabama honey to promote the movie.
“We’re selling them through the production company Black Bear, so they’re the ones that have all the rights, the branding and all that kind of stuff. We’re supplying the honey for them. We were the beekeepers in the movie, and the honey that was used in the movie is all Alabama honey.”
Adam Hickman, owner of Foxhound Bee Company
You can buy a limited edition “honey bear” on the Black Bear Pictures website.

McConaughey’s Bee Training

The highly-acclaimed film shot throughout the Birmingham-metro area in the summer of 2023 is a thriller about a beekeeper fending off threats to his honey business.
In his recent appearance on the Tonight Show with Jimmy Fallon, McConaughey, who is allergic to bee stings, described what it was like to hold 12,000 bees – without CGI and more importantly not getting stung.
Hickman and his crew (Foxhound, Eastaboga Bee Company, Choctaw Bee Company,) worked on the beekeeping scenes, trained the actors, provided the equipment and consulted on the movie.
“They brought us on to do all of the beekeeping scenes. We ended up training actors how to look like beekeepers; supplied all the bees and did all the really complicated bee scenes. We also ended up providing a lot of the equipment, boxes and extractors.”
Adam Hickman,owner of Foxhound Bee Company
